The payroll resources ensure all elements of payroll are completed accurately and timely, providing analytical and research support for account reconciliations and problem resolutions. This position involves researching, testing, and implementing required changes related to system updates, processes, and policy changes.
Looking for candidates with strong accounting fundamentals and working knowledge of payroll, who can manage payroll processing, payroll accounting, reconciliations, and statutory compliance in a fast paced environment.
Key Responsibilities:
• Payroll Processing: Calculate and process salaries, overtime, bonuses, and deductions (tax, benefits) in a timely manner.
• Compliance & Tax: Ensure strict adherence to federal, state, and local tax laws; prepare and submit payroll tax reports.
• Accounting: End to end accounting with payroll.
• General Ledger Maintenance: Reconcile payroll-related general ledger accounts and prepare journal entries.
• Support month‑end close activities related to payroll accounting, Post payroll journals and ensure accurate mapping in the general ledger.
• System Administration: Update and maintain payroll software, including employee data, hires, terminations, and leave tracking.
• Reporting & Auditing: Generate reports for management review and participate in payroll audits.
• Employee Support: Resolve payroll-related inquiries and discrepancies efficiently
• Systems & Process Improvement: Work on payroll systems and ERP tools such as ADP, Oracle, JDE (or equivalent).

Yum! Brands, Inc., based in Louisville, Kentucky, and its subsidiaries franchise or operate a system of over 60,000 restaurants in more than 155 countries and territories under the Company’s concepts – KFC, Taco Bell, Pizza Hut and the Habit Burger Grill. The Company's KFC, Taco Bell and Pizza Hut brands are global leaders of the chicken, Mexican-style food, and pizza categories, respectively. The Habit Burger Grill is a fast casual restaurant concept specializing in made-to-order chargrilled burgers, sandwiches and more.
